Transplanting for Life: Understanding the Process
Organ transplantation is a complex and often life-saving medical intervention. It involves harvesting an organ from one person, the provider, and implanting it into another person, the recipient. This extraordinary feat of medicine offers a second chance at life for individuals with failing organs.
Various factors influence the donation process, including organ match. The beneficiary's health, blood type, and tissue compatibility are all crucial considerations.
- Physiological professionals work tirelessly to ensure a successful graft by carefully evaluating both donors and recipients.
- Once|the suitable donor is found, the operative team performs a delicate procedure.
- Afterward|transplantation, recipients require lifelong observation and may need to take anti-rejection drugs to prevent organ decline.
